Merger and Acquisitions Report: Apple Set To Buy Color, Amazon Poised For Brazil

It is said that Apple (NASDAQ:AAPL) is poised to purchase Color, which at one time was a hyped mobile photo-sharing startup that has since failed. It seems that the latter’s patents might be tempting Apple, reports The Next Web.

Amazon.com (NASDAQ:AMZN) is said by Bloomberg to be in discussions to acquire the Brazilian bookseller Saraiva, which at this time has a market cap of $356 million, and is both a publisher and retailer of books online and in physical stores. Meanwhile, the possibility of Amazon entering Brazil seems to be causing worries for MercadoLibre (NASDAQ:MELI), which shares have already fallen on the report.
